Developing PIRN Research Groups

This short survey invites you to join one of the PIRN research subgroups.

This will let you get in touch with other permaculturist, share knowledge and findings, develop research projects together benefiting from this platform that connects people from all around the world!

The first six group you will find listed were originated from a workshop of seventy permaculture researchers from a dozen countries, held in London on 10th September 2015. The last one, “permaculture and climate change”, has been recently added to reflect and research on how permaculture can tackle this important issue.

Volunteers, interns and the Permaculture Association will be continuing to assist this project, but the main goal is to let it stand on its own two feet. To this aim, members will be the backbone of it. For PIRN to flourish, it needs your help, your enthusiasm and your willingness to put a little time into it.
